Police Ask for Help Finding Burglary Suspect
Police say the man in the photo has twice tried to break into kiosks at the Citadel Mall after hours
CHARLESTON - Police are looking for a man, possibly with a glass eye or who wears some type of reflective contact lens, who is suspected of attempting to break into vendor kiosks in the Citadel Mall after closing on at least two occasions.
According to a report, someone has attempted to break into the cash drawers of two different vendor kiosks at the mall on three separate occasions: Aug. 28, Aug. 31 and Sept. 4.
One of the kiosks recorded surveillance video footage of two of the attempts and police are asking for help from area residents in identifying and locating the suspect.
